A Rajshahi tribunal on Tuesday sentenced two people to death and three others to life term imprisonment for killing Rajshahi University teacher professor Rezaul Karim Siddiquee in 2016.

After examining records and witnesses, Rajshahi Speedy Trial Tribunal judge Shirin Kabita Akhter handed down the verdict in presence of the three convicts on the dock, reports UNB.

The condemned convicts are Shariful Islam, a student of RU English department and Maskawat Hossain Sakib alias Abdullah, from Bogura. Shariful tried in absentia.

The lifers are Rahmatullah, a student of Rajshahi University, Abdus Sattar and his son Ripon Ali of Poba upazila.

According to the prosecution, on 8 November 2016, police pressed charges against eight members of banned militant outfit Jama’atul Mujahideen Bangladesh (JMB) in the case more than six months after the killing.

Of them, Badal, Nazrul and Osman were killed in gunfights with police at different times and Shariful has been on the run.

Professor Rezaul Karim, 58, of RU english department, was killed by miscreants in the city’s Shalbagan area while he was waiting for university bus on 23 April 2011.

The victim’s son Sourov Hossain filed a murder case with Boalia police station.
